FM Camp took a trip to Montana in the Fall of 1917. While in Ovando, Montana, he sent a postcard to his daughter Nellie reminding her to put water in the car battery. Oh, and there was a deer in the meadow.
A present day photograph of the buildings from the postcard. According to the photgrapher, Marcin Porwit, the Stray Bullet Cafe has the best gravy he has ever tasted. Mr. Porwit also has additional photographs of Ovando, including the post office from which the postcard was mailed 94 years ago.
